© 2019, IEOM Society International. The research aims to apply Six Sigma to solve the quality problem of the collection center. It does not meet the final recycler's specification for 3% +/-0.15% impurities in the delivered post-consumer polymer bales. By applying the first two phases of DMAIC a Cp = 0.26 and Cpk = -4.9 was determined. After applying the last three phases, the improved indices are Cp = 1.8 and Cpk = 1.78. Therefore, it can be concluded that the post-consumer polymer collection center has an adequate and satisfactory process. With an average of 3% +/-0.022% so it meets the impurity specifications of the final recycler.
